Output 2c23dd012557db9447b7d0c1b06bf5a20d9ea2e8b22f35dfd102ba5dce87eafc:5

value
34238711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b516bc55c4c1beebbbf246b90dff92234ee2611a OP_EQUAL
address
MQQfmrWmY7Y2qHp2c41unkpKsBksjpWtap
transaction
2c23dd012557db9447b7d0c1b06bf5a20d9ea2e8b22f35dfd102ba5dce87eafc
spent
true